Med-Surg II HESI Exam Set Two, Answered 100% Correct {All Answers Verified + Rationale} A client with diabetes is taking insulin lispro (Humalog) injections. The nurse should advise the client to eat: 1. Within 10 to 15 minutes after the injection. 2. 1 hour after the injection. 3. At any time, because timing of meals with lispro injections is unnecessary. 4. 2 hours before the injection. {{Correct Ans:- 1 The best indicator that the client has learned how to give an insulin self-injection correctly is when the client can: 1. Perform the procedure safely and correctly. 2. Critique the nurse's performance of the procedure. 3. Explain all steps of the procedure correctly. 4. Correctly answer a post-test about the procedure. {{Correct Ans:- 1 The nurse is instructing the client on insulin administration. The client is performing a return demonstration for preparing the insulin. The client's morning dose of insulin is 10 units of regular and 22 units of NPH. The nurse checks the dose accuracy with the client. The nurse determines that the client has prepared the correct dose when the syringe reads how many units? ____________________ units. {{Correct Ans:- 32 units Angiotensin-converting enzyme (ACE) inhibitors may be prescribed for the client with diabetes mellitus to reduce vascular changes and posterm-3sibly prevent or delay development of: 1. Ch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D). 2. Pancreatic cancer. 3. Renal failure. 4. Cerebrovascular accident. {{Correct Ans:- 3 The nurse should teach the diabetic client that which of the following is the most common symptom of hypoglycaemia? 1. Nervousness. 2. Anorexia. 3. Kussmaul's respirations. 4. Bradycardia. {{Correct Ans:- 1 The nurse is assessing the client's use of medications. Which of the following medications may cause a complication with the treatment plan of a client with diabetes? 1. Aspirin. 2. Steroids. 3. Sulfonylureas. 4. Angiotensin-converting enzyme (ACE) inhibitors. {{Correct Ans:- 2 A client with type 1 diabetes mellitus has influenza. The nurse should instruct the client to: 1. Increase the frequency of self-monitoring (blood glucose testing). 2. Reduce food intake to diminish nausea. 3. Discontinue that dose of insulin if unable to eat. 4. Take half of the normal dose of insulin. {{Correct Ans:- 1
